Bare ActsThe City of Panaji Corporation Act, 2002

Section 78

Resumption by Government

Amendment status not verified — confirm the current text below against the official source.

Resumption by Government.— The State Government may resume any immovable property transferred to the Corporation by itself or by any local authority, where such property is required for a public purpose, without payment of any compensation other than the amount, paid by the Corporation for such transfer and the market value at the date of resumption of any buildings or works subsequently erected or executed thereon by the Corporation with the intention that such buildings or works should be permanent: --51-- Provided that compensation need not be paid for buildings or works constructed or erected in contravention of the terms of the transfer.
